What is the Application for Development Approval?
The Application for Development Approval is a critical form utilized within Western Australia to request the green light for proposed development works. This form serves the vital purpose of ensuring that development projects adhere to local laws and guidelines, safeguarding the community’s interests. Submitting this application is essential for obtaining permits required for any developmental activities, which must be approved by local government planning departments.
Through this process, applicants demonstrate compliance with the Western Australia local planning scheme, thereby facilitating a smoother development approval application.

Who Should Fill Out the Application for Development Approval?
Both the Owner and Applicant play distinct and essential roles in completing the Application for Development Approval. Generally, the Owner is the landholder, while the Applicant may be a representative or agent acting on behalf of the Owner. Individuals interested in filling out this application must meet eligibility criteria, including appropriate qualifications and representations pertinent to the project.
This application is commonly required in scenarios such as land use changes, which necessitate official approval to ensure that all local planning regulations are met. Understanding the responsibilities and eligibility is paramount for both parties involved.

Who is eligible to submit the Application for Development Approval?
Any property owner or applicant who is proposing development works or land use changes in Western Australia can submit this application. It is important that all parties involved are duly authorized to represent the application.
Are there deadlines for submitting this form?
While specific deadlines can vary by local government, it is recommended to check with your local planning department. Early submission is advised to allow time for any potential revisions or consultations needed.
How should I submit the Application for Development Approval?
The completed form should be submitted to your local government planning department. Depending on the council, submissions may be accepted electronically via email or through a dedicated online portal.
What supporting documents do I need to include with the application?
Typically, you will need to include property details, plans or drawings of the proposed development, and any additional documents required by your local planning authority. Check specific requirements for your area.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include failing to sign the form, leaving required fields blank, or providing inaccurate information. Ensure all sections are completed thoroughly and review them before submission.
What is the processing time for the Application for Development Approval?
Processing times vary by local government and the complexity of the application. Generally, it can take several weeks to several months. Check with your local planning department for specific timelines.
Can I amend my application after submission?
In most cases, amendments can be made, but it is essential to contact your local planning department as soon as possible to understand the process and any potential implications.
